Why I Chose American Roadstar Sport A/S Tires
I needed tires that could handle a variety of weather conditions without breaking the bank. The Sport A/S tires promised good all-season performance with a sportier tread design. Their competitive price point and positive reviews made them a tempting option, so I decided to give them a try.
Tread Design and Performance
One of the first things I noticed was the aggressive yet balanced tread pattern. It provides solid traction on both wet and dry roads. During rainy days, the tires did a good job channeling water away, reducing the risk of hydroplaning. On dry pavement, they offered a confident grip and responsive handling that made my daily drives more enjoyable.
Comfort and Noise Levels
Comfort is important to me, and the American Roadstar Sport A/S tires delivered a smooth ride. While they aren’t the quietest tires I’ve ever used, the road noise was minimal and didn’t become distracting on longer trips. Overall, I felt the balance between performance and comfort was well maintained.
Durability and Wear
After several thousand miles, I checked the tread wear and was pleasantly surprised by how evenly the tires wore. The rubber compound seems durable, which is encouraging for a tire in this price range. I expect them to last a decent amount of time if I keep up with regular maintenance like rotations and proper inflation.
Handling in Different Weather Conditions
Since I live in an area with unpredictable weather, I tested these tires in light snow and cold conditions as well. While they are not winter tires, they handled light snow adequately for an all-season tire. They gave me enough confidence to drive safely, but I would recommend switching to dedicated winter tires if you face heavy snow or ice regularly.
